Aquafaba Substitutes

Chickpea canning liquid that whips to stiff peaks, used as an egg white replacer.

Common uses for Aquafaba: meringue, macarons, mayonnaise, mousse, vegan baking. The best substitute usually depends on which of these functions, flavor, moisture, fat, binding, or leavening, you most need to preserve.

Every documented substitute for Aquafaba

Ranked by quality score (1–5, where 5 is virtually identical). Check the ratio and context tags before swapping, not every substitution is 1:1.

Egg Whites
Excellent
Ratio: 3 tbsp egg whites = 3 tbsp aquafaba

If not vegan, real egg whites are superior for structure and stability.

Best for: meringue, macarons, mousse
Commercial Egg White Replacer
Good
Ratio: 2 tbsp powder + 2 tbsp water per 3 tbsp aquafaba

Brands like Bob's Red Mill Egg Replacer work well for whipped applications.

Best for: meringue, angel food, macarons, mousse
Flax Egg (ground flax + water)
Partial
Ratio: 3 tbsp aquafaba = 1 flax egg (1 tbsp flax + 3 tbsp water)

Does not whip to peaks like aquafaba. Use only for binding in dense baked goods.

Best for: vegan baking, binding
Silken Tofu (blended, for density)
Partial
Ratio: 3 tbsp blended silken tofu = 3 tbsp aquafaba (for binding only)

Does not whip to peaks. Use only for binding in dense baked goods.

Best for: vegan binding, brownies, dense cakes
